Strong Final Day Propels Women's Swimming to Fourth-Place Finish at the Fall Frenzy Invitational

CHARLOTTE, N.C. - A strong final day on Sunday (Nov. 19) propelled UNC Asheville Women's Swimming to a fourth-place finish at the Fall Frenzy Invitational hosted by Queens University of Charlotte.

Through the morning preliminaries, Asheville logged 23 season-best times and one lifetime-best time while landing four in the A finals, six in the B finals and five in the C finals.

Grace Adams secured her spot in the A final of the 200-yard backstroke with an eighth-place season-best finish in 2:02.21, while Alessia Cunegatti qualified for the B finals in the event finishing in 2:05.07. Amelia Presley logged a lifetime-best time of 2:08.18, while Addison Wright (2:10.34) and Tess Peny (2:11.96) each registered season-bests in the event. Abby Parks posted a second-place finish in the 100-yard freestyle to qualify for the A final in a season-best 50.39 seconds, while Anna Marcotti (52.25 seconds) and Ava Kilpatrick (52.45 seconds) each registered season-best times in the event to qualify for the C final. Danai Gkogkosi (53.00 seconds), Taylor Smith (53.22 seconds), Olivia Ciancimino (54.36 seconds) and Rachel Daly (54.66 seconds) each recorded season-best times in the event. Beatrice Cocconcelli qualified for the A final in the 200-yard breaststroke in a season-best time of 2:21.45 to finish eighth, while Miriam Wheatley (2:22.67), Gracelyn Cox (2:22.78) and Anna Kate Halligan (2:23.08) all logged season-bests to qualify for the B final. Julie Lahiff qualified for the C final in a season-best 2:25.12, while Jane Brierley (2:26.15), Rose Sciaudone (2:29.03), Gaby Shenot (2:29.36) and Alexis Walker (2:39.05) all logged season-best times in the event. Caroline Crouse logged a third-place finish in the 200-yard butterfly in a season-best 2:01.88 to qualify for the A final, while Riley Edmundson (2:05.97) and Chloe McDonald (2:07.39, season-best) each qualified for the B final. Lahiff (2:09.94) and Peny (2:10.68) each recorded season-best times and qualified for the C final in the event.

Caitlin Hefner finished 10th in the mile (1650-yard) freestyle with a season-best 17:17.14, while Sciaudone posted a season-best 17:57.45 in the event. Grace Adams finished fifth in the 200-yard backstroke with a lifetime-best 2:01.80, while Cunegatti posted a lifetime-best 2:03.29 in the event to finish 14th. Parks finished third in the 100-yard freestyle in 50.40 seconds, while Marcotti (52.16 seconds) and Kilpatrick (52.52 seconds) each logged season-best times in the event. Cocconcelli posted a seventh-place finish in the 200-yard breaststroke with a season-best 2:20.48, while Halligan finished 12th with a lifetime-best 2:21.67. Cox finished 13th in a season-best 2:22.18, while Wheatley finished 15th with a mark of 2:22.72. Lahiff also competed in the event, finishing in 2:26.62. Asheville's highlight of the finals was Crouse's victory in the 200-yard butterfly, as she won the event with a school record and NCAA B Cut time of 1:59.07. Edmundson finished ninth in the event in 2:03.76, while McDonald also finished 13th with a season-best time of 2:06.40. Peny logged a season-best 2:08.47 in the event, while Lahiff also registered a season-best 2:08.61. Asheville notched a sixth-place finish in the 400-yard freestyle relay, with the quartet of Crouse, Parks, Kilpatrick and Marcotti finishing in 3:25.19 anchored by a lifetime-best 50.18 split from Crouse. The team of Gkogkosi, Ciancimino, Cunegatti and Presley also finished the event in 3:32.65.

In total, Asheville logged nine season-bests and five lifetime-bests en route to a fourth-place finish in the team standings.
 
"We had a really exciting mid-season meet where team members were able to execute race plans and strategies," said head coach Elizabeth Lykins. "Earning so many lifetime bests, season best and a few school records too really proves the work is paying off. To top off the meet with an NCAA B-Cut was icing on the cake!"
 
"It has been so fulfilling to compete in my last midseason with such a supportive team, these ladies are so inspiring and have brought an endless smile to my face this weekend!" said senior team captain Gaby Shenot. "I am so thankful my last midseason gave me so many new memories with the best team!"
 
The Bulldogs return to the water on Dec. 16 to host Georgia Southern. The action begins at 11:00 a.m. from the Justice Center Pool.
